Mark your calendar for March 17, 9:00 am -11:00 am and get to the Mesa County Workforce Center. This Job Fair Boot Camp is broken into four 30 minute workshops facilitated by local Human Resources personnel. Get the inside scoop on how to successfully market yourself. The workshop begins at 9:00 am. Get there early and ready to learn!
Workshops Include
-Understanding the Application Process from a Recruiter’s Perspective
-Résumé 102: An In-depth Approach to Résumé Writing
-Interview Prep 101
-Answering Behavioral Interview Questions
